AP CM to make Amaravati as an Iconic City

Amaravati, Sept 23: The Andhra Pradesh Chief Minister N Chandrababu Naidu stated on Friday that building Andhra Pradesh is his only aim and capital Amravati should be built as an iconic city.

"Building Andhra Pradesh is my only aim now. Amravati should be built as an iconic city. I developed Hyderabad to international level. Now my focus is on Amravati. That's why I decided June 2 as a day of Nava Nirmana Deeksha, but not as formation day of Andhra Pradesh," Chief Minister Naidu said.

"I understood the then need for constructive moment. That's why joined hands with the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) and started working for the new state," he said.

Naidu further said that 'Swachh Andhra' is his priority and for that, construction of toilets is at war footage.

Talking about his other focus areas of work, he said that water for irrigation and drinking is also in his priority list.

The Chief Minister said that his aim is to achieve 80% public satisfaction regarding government policies, and turning 80% public in favor of Telugu Desam Party (TDP).

"In the changed conditions, we want to take our party to every household. We wanted to get feedback from people on their satisfaction and grievances. In 11 days our party leadership could reach almost 20 lakh households," Naidu said.
